The original was posted on /r/linux_gaming by /u/skincr on 2024-09-28 01:01:43+00:00. *** I use the same PC with two SSDs. One has Linux (Mint) on it, other has Windows, so I can compare games in both operating systems. Here is few of my experiences.
Hearts of Iron 4: Runs 50% faster on Linux, in a heavy mod like Millennium Dawn, in my tests. Game loading time is like 30 seconds on Linux to 5 minutes in Windows, in Millennium Dawn. So I don't play HOI4 on Windows anymore. Definitely play on Linux.
Europa Universalis 4: Runs better on Linux, significant loading time difference compared to Windows.
Stellaris: I didn't test it, but it uses same engine as HOI4 and EU4, so I guess there would be similar results.
Daggerfall Unity, heavily modded: This game from 1996 is demanding resources like it is a brand new game on Windows but runs so smoothly on Linux. Definitely play on Linux.
Not much difference, or worse in Linux:
Crusader Kings 3: Don't have much difference. Some heavy mods like AGOT are running better on Windows.
Victoria 3: I didn't see much difference.

A small introduction of what its Proton-Sarek for the people that dont the project:
Proton-Sarek (Proton-For-Old-Vulkan) its a custom Proton build with DXVK 1.10.3 for users with GPUs that support Vulkan 1.1+ but not Vulkan 1.3, or for those with non-Vulkan support who want a plug-and-play option featuring personal patches.
Why it does exist?:
Because there are still users with GPUs that support Vulkan 1.1+ but not Vulkan 1.3, as well as others with non-Vulkan support. Those who can use DXVK often rely on older Proton versions, which suffer from lower compatibility and performance compared to newer builds. Meanwhile, users dependent on WineD3D frequently face poor gaming experiences. This repository provides patched versions of Proton and/or Proton-GE, offering better performance with DXVK v1.10.3 and significant improvements to WineD3D, ensuring a smoother experience for both Vulkan and non-Vulkan setups.

Stable Async Build: ===================
A new build :). Its just like the Stable build but will use DXVK 1.10.3 Async instead of the normal one.
Why DXVK Async?
Why? Simple, performance. The key difference in DXVK Async is that it enables asynchronous shader compilation, whereas the regular DXVK uses synchronous compilation.
In regular DXVK, when a game encounters new shaders, they are compiled synchronously, causing the game to stutter or freeze briefly while the shader is being processed. This is because the game must wait for the compilation to finish before continuing.
In DXVK Async, the shaders are compiled in the background while the game continues running. Instead of freezing or stuttering, the game proceeds, though there might be minor graphical artifacts until the shaders are fully compiled.
Then why isn't on the normal version?
While DXVK Async offers significant performance improvements by reducing stuttering through asynchronous shader compilation, it carries a potential risk of triggering client-side anti-cheat systems in multiplayer games. This risk exists because the tool modifies how shaders are handled, which might be interpreted as a cheat or manipulation by some anti-cheat software.
Although there haven't been any confirmed cases of players getting banned for using DXVK Async, the possibility remains. Given this, I personally wouldn’t take the chance with something as valuable as a Steam account.

The original was posted on /r/linux_gaming by /u/timkurvers on 2024-09-24 18:55:53+00:00. *** When a game refuses to run under Wine / Proton, the first (technical) port of call may be to scour the debug log for indicators of the problem. For Proton these logs can be enabled using
PROTON_LOG=1
as indicated in the Proton FAQ. Unfortunately for us humans, these Wine debug logs tend to be rather unwieldy.I originally posted about Wine Log Explorer on r/wine\_gaming, but it seems to work well for Proton logs, too. It is a web tool which parses debug log files into interactive tree structures, including the ability to filter by process / thread + searching in free text: see the screenshot below.
It's fully client-side, so no files leave your browser. Hopefully this tool can help clarify why a game behaves or crashes in a certain way, in particular for games that prevent attaching debuggers.
